Remove/Install Bottom Paneling For Dashboard On Driver Side - AR68.10-P-1501MFA

Model 118, 177, 243, 247

REMOVINGINSTALLING Remove/install     
1 Adjust steering column upward.    
2 Move left front seat all the way to the rear.    
3 Switch off ignition and store transmitter key outside of transmitter range (min. 2 m).    
4 Unscrew screws (2).    
5 Carefully pull trim (1) downward until electric lines are accessible. IMPORTANT Observe guides (arrow B).  
6 Remove screw (3) and remove hood lock release (4) from trim (1). SPECIAL TOOL Long wedge Fig 1
7 Unhook hood cable from the hood lock release (4) and remove hood lock release (4) from vehicle.    
8 Release lock (8) from diagnostic connector (X11/4) and push diagnostic connector (X11/4) through and up.    
9 Release electrical connector from footwell lamp and disconnect.    
10 Release electrical connector of the speaker (6) and disconnect.    
11 Remove electrical wiring harness from trim (1) (arrow C).    
12 Unclip electrical plug socket (5) from trim (1) (arrows D). IMPORTANT Do not disconnect electrical plug socket (5).  
13 Remove trim (1) from vehicle.    
14 Install in the reverse order.
